Magic Show vs Hypnosis Show: Which Is Right for Your Fair?

Updated: 7 days ago

Lance Gifford performing a magic show with a dog on stage


Choosing between a magic show and a hypnosis show for your fair comes down to your audience, your schedule, and the experience you want to create. A magic show delivers a large-scale visual spectacle with animals and illusions for all ages. A hypnosis show delivers live audience-driven comedy that is different every single performance. Many fair organizers book both — and for good reason.


What Is the Core Difference Between a Magic Show and a Hypnosis Show?

Both shows are professional, family-friendly, and built specifically for fair and festival environments. But they work differently and create different crowd experiences.

A magic show is a visual, high-production performance. The entertainer controls the experience from start to finish — delivering illusions, introducing live animals, and pulling audience members into carefully crafted moments of wonder and comedy.

A hypnosis show puts the audience in control. Volunteers from the crowd step on stage, enter a hypnotic state, and respond to suggestions in ways that create completely spontaneous, unscripted comedy. No two hypnosis shows are ever the same.

Which Show Should You Book for Your Fair?



Book a magic show if:

  • Your audience includes a high proportion of young children and families

  • You want a visually impressive centrepiece act for your main stage

  • You are booking entertainment for a single-day event

Book a hypnosis show if:

  • Your event runs multiple days, and you want repeat visitors to see something new

  • Your audience skews toward teenagers and adults

  • You want maximum social media buzz and word-of-mouth energy

Book both if:

  • Your fair runs two or more days

  • You want to offer a complete entertainment variety

  • You want every segment of your audience fully covered

The most successful county fairs and state fairs book both formats. Running a magic show and a hypnosis show on alternating slots throughout the day gives your crowd two completely different entertainment experiences — maximising attendance, dwell time, and satisfaction across every demographic.
